X'HO
Local Radical
The voice of radio is also the voice of rebellion.
X'Ho, 'forever 27', ever vocal on Singapore society and culture, has even compiled his columns into two books.
The ex-Rediffusion DJ is also credited with introducing alternative and New Wave music to local music diets.
'I never set out to be a careerist - I was primarily a music fan and I'd simply wanted to expose Singaporeans to what I thought was good music,' he said.
'Ultimately, I'm very old school. As a deejay, I believe that if you've nothing to say, shut up.'
X'Ho has just formed a new band - Zircon Gov. Pawnstarz - with guitarist Tan Tiang Yeow and ex-deejay Suzanne Walker.
Asked how he'd react if he had to introduce a Pawnstarz hit on air, he squealed: 'Ooo, I'd be so shy! No lah, I couldn't play my own song! Maybe in the clubs but not radio!'
Claim to fame: X'Ho introduced ground-breaking music to local listeners. He has released three solo albums and written two books.
Catch him: X'Ho spins at the Soundbar on Fridays from 9pm.
Pawnstarz is putting the finishing touches on its debut album, Follywood, and hopes to open for Blondie when and if the '80s band makes it to Singapore (the band cancelled its December gig).

Cheap stunt - FEB 17, 2004
Suzanne Walker makes a clean breast of that chest-baring act
THE morning after she hijacked the headlines by lifting her T-shirt halfway up her chest at the MTV Asia Awards red carpet, Suzanne Walker was still basking in the publicity.
Photo by SHIN MIN
To the suggestion that she might have offended some folks with her stunt, the 34-year-old DJ said on the phone: 'It's MTV. It's not a charity gala.'
She just wanted to take the mickey out of the show, she added.
'But you guys took it seriously,' she said in her husky voice, and laughed.
Walker, who is a singer in DJ X'Ho's new electro band, Zircon Gov. Pawnstarz, proceeded to do a promotional pitch for the group: 'Our video is released next week. Our album is launched next month. So, thank you very much.'
She and the band's leader, Ho, had hatched a plan to do something outrageous on the red carpet when they were walking from the carpark, she said.
Either he would flash the crowd or she would flaunt the lower halves of her orbs.
Alas, he had no wish to be arrested. So, she had to go it alone.
When contacted, Ho, who is 'forever 27', said he had warned Walker that 'this is Singapore, honey. You can only show so much'.
Even if the stunt was in bad taste, he said, it was in 'good bad taste'.
Cameramen from about 100 media organisations were glad to capture Walker's mock-pornstar act. Some of the 400 fans screamed when they saw her. Others looked indifferent.
Photographers from overseas news services such as AFP and Associated Press did not know who she was.
Instead, they thought she was a 'stunt performer' sending up singer Janet Jackson's breast-baring incident.
But Walker insisted 'it wasn't a Janet Jackson'.
Although she was wearing 'a see-through Princess Tam Tam bra', she covered her nipples with her hands throughout, she said.
